1.Emodin Inhibits Expressions of RhoA and ROCK to Attenuate Lipopolysaccharide-Induced Podocyte Injury
Yuan GAN ; Xiaoguang FAN ; Lijiao WANG ; Guofeng LI ; Yujie ZHOU
Journal of Guangzhou University of Traditional Chinese Medicine 2025;42(4):962-968
Objective To observe the improvement effect and mechanism of emodin on lipopolysaccharide(LPS)-induced podocyte injury.Methods Human glomerular podocytes were used as the study object,and they were randomly divided into the blank control group,the LPS group,the emodin low-,medium-,and high-dose groups,and the emodin+lysophosphatidic acid[LP A,RhoA/RhoRho-associatedcoiled-coil kinase(ROCK)activator]group.Cell counting kit 8(CCK8)and 5-ethynyl-2'-deoxyuridine(EdU)staining were applied to detect the proliferation of glomerular podocytes,Transwell assay was used to test the migration of glomerular podocytes,flow cytometry was used to detect apoptosis of glomerular podocytes,and enzyme-linked immunosorbent assay(ELISA)was used to detect the levels of inflammatory factors tumor necrosis factor α(TNF-α),interleukin(IL)-1β,and IL-18 in the supernatant of glomerular podocytes,and the protein expression levels of RhoA and ROCK in glomerular podocytes were determined by Western Blot.Results The optical density(OD)450nm,EdU positive cell rate and migration number of glomerular podocytes in the LPS group were lower than those in the blank control group,and the apoptosis rate,the levels of TNF-α,IL-1β and IL-18 in the supernatant,as well as the protein expression levels of RhoA and ROCK in the cells were higher than those in the blank control group,the differences being statistically significant(P<0.05);the OD450nm,EdU positive cell rate and migration number of glomerular podocytes in the emodin low-,medium-,and high-dose groups were higher than those in the LPS group,while the apoptosis rate,levels of TNF-α,IL-1 β and IL-18 in supernatant,as well as RhoA and ROCK protein expression levels in cells were reduced compared with those in the LPS group,the differences being statistically significant(P<0.05);the OD450nm and EdU positive cell rate and migration number of glomerular podocytes in LPA group were lower than those of emodin high-dose group,while the apoptosis rate,levels of TNF-α,IL-1 βand IL-18 in supernatant,as well as RhoA and ROCK protein expression levels in cells were higher than those of emodin high-dose group,the differences being all statistically significant(P<0.05).Conclusion Emodin can improve LPS-induced podocyte injury,and its mechanism of action may be related to the inhibition of RhoA/ROCK signaling pathway.
2.Efficacy of total laparoscopic radical cystectomy with intracorporeal ileal conduit urinary diversion: a report of 25 cases
Sihao WANG ; Bohan FAN ; Yue XU ; Liming SONG ; Xiaoguang ZHOU ; Xiaopeng HU ; Wei WANG
Journal of Modern Urology 2024;29(4):312-316
【Objective】 To investigate the efficacy and surgical technique of total laparoscopic radical cystectomy with intracorporeal ileal conduit urinary diversion, so as to provide reference for the selection of surgery for patients with bladder cancer. 【Methods】 Clinical data of 48 patients with bladder cancer who underwent laparoscopic radical cystectomy during Mar.2017 and Aug.2022 in our hospital were retrospectively analyzed, including 23 cases who received traditional laparoscopic radical cystectomy combined with extracorporeal ileal conduit, and 25 who received total laparoscopic radical cystectomy with intracorporeal ileal conduit.The operation time, blood loss, postoperative intestinal function recovery time, drainage tube removal time and hospital stay were compared between the two groups. 【Results】 All procedures were successfully performed, and no Clavien-Dindo>grade 3 complications were observed.The operation time, and amount of estimated blood loss of the traditional group and total laparoscopic radical group were (227.0±46.4) min vs. (253.6±58.9) min, and (131.7±79.8) mL vs. (154.0±93.0) mL, respectively.There were no differences in postoperative intestinal function recovery time and drainage tube removal time (P>0.05).The hospital stay was shorter in the total laparoscopic radical group than in the traditional group (P=0.035). 【Conclusion】 Total laparoscopic radical cystectomy with intracorporeal ileal conduit urinary diversion is safe and feasible.which is comparable to the traditional laparoscopic surgery, while the hospital stay in the total laparoscopic group is shorter, which is conducive to rapid postoperative recovery.
3.Informatics Consideration on the Hierarchical System of Rare Diseases Clinical Care in China
Mengchun GONG ; Yanying GUO ; Xihong ZHENG ; Junkang FAN ; Peng LIU ; Ling NIU ; Yining YANG ; Xiaoguang ZOU
JOURNAL OF RARE DISEASES 2024;3(4):527-534
The diagnosis and treatment resources for rare diseases in China are highly imbalanced. The basic diagnosis and treatment capabilities are weak, the diagnosis period for patients is long, and the rates of missed diagnosis and misdiagnosis are relatively high. The establishment of a hierarchical diagnosis and treatment system is the inevitable approach to enhancing the diagnosis and treatment standards of rare diseases. Currently, the implementation of the domestic hierarchical diagnosis and treatment system for rare diseases still confronts numerous challenges, such as ambiguous referral standards and processes of primary medical institutions, and ineffective information interaction among institutions at all levels. Thus, it is essential to facilitate high-level information construction for the hierarchical diagnosis and treatment of rare diseases. This paper explores the process of constructing a multidisciplinary joint remote diagnosis and treatment platform and a health management platform through informatization, with the hope of establishing two closed loops of digital diagnosis and treatment services and health follow-up management for patients with rare diseases, as well as achieving timely diagnosis and lifelong health management for patients. It integrates and optimizes auxiliary diagnostic tools, promotes the rapid dissemination of rare disease diagnosis and treatment experiences to the grassroots, enhances the information construction level of the hierarchical diagnosis and treatment system, and endeavors to address the practical predicament of weak diagnosis and treatment capabilities of rare diseases in grassroots medical institutions. Additionally, this paper proposes an essential approach for multi-dimensional independent innovation to guide the popularization of efficient and high-quality rare disease diagnosis and treatment services. By encompassing innovating the rare disease diagnosis and treatment collaboration network and multidisciplinary diagnosis and treatment model, facilitating the application of the latest biomedical and informatics technologies to the grassroots, and constructing a national intelligent data platform for rare disease innovation, a new model for rare disease services with Chinese characteristics will be established. This will significantly enhance the medical treatment level of rare diseases in China and strive for more benefits for patients.
4.Correlation between screen time, screen behavior type and anxiety, depression among children and adolescents in Jiangxi Province
CHEN Ting, LUO Yaling, HU Huaxiong, SONG Xiaoguang, CHEN Fuhui, FAN Yi, FANG Xiaoyan, ZHU Hui
Chinese Journal of School Health 2024;45(3):370-374
Objective:
To analyze the status and correlation between screen time, screen behavior type, and anxiety, depression among children and adolescents in Jiangxi Province, so as to provide a basis for effective intervention measures.
Methods:
Using the method of stratified random sampling, 8 851 primary and secondary school students in 11 districts of Jiangxi Province were investigated by questionnaire during September to December in 2020. Anxiety and depression status were investigated using the State Trait Anxiety Inventory (STAI) and the Center for Epidemiological Studies Depression Scale for Children(CES-DC), respectively. Single factor analysis using χ 2-test, t-test,analysis of variance,and multivariate analysis using generalized linear models.
Results:
On school days and weekends, 4.7% and 20.4% of primary and secondary school students in Jiangxi Province had a total screen time of over 2 hours per day, respectively. The weighted scores of the total screen time (primary school students: 1.88± 0.68, junior middle school students: 1.96±0.71, high school students: 2.03±0.80) and time spent for playing video games (primary school students: 1.51±0.64, junior middle school students: 1.62±0.69, high school students: 1.68±0.75) daily showed an upward trend with the increase of educational stage ( F =31.48, 42.13), and with significantly higher in boys (1.97±0.74, 1.66± 0.72) than girls (1.93±0.72, 1.53±0.66)( t =2.48, 9.07)( P <0.05). The average scores of state anxiety and trait anxiety were (42.20±9.05) and (40.65±9.85), which showed an upward trend with the increase of educational stage ( F =168.12, 241.98 ), and were higher in girls than boys ( t =6.63, 8.48)( P <0.01). The average score of depression was (11.99±11.00), which was lower in elementary school students than middle school students and high school students ( F =136.42), with significantly higher in girls ( t =6.85)( P <0.01). On school days, with the increase of total screen time and time spent for playing video games daily, the risk of state anxiety, trait anxiety, and depression among primary and secondary school students significantly increased ( OR = 6.70- 818.98, P <0.01). On weekends, among primary and secondary school students, the total screen time of >1-2 hours daily reduced the risk of state anxiety ( OR =0.30). The risk of developing trait anxiety among students playing video games for more than 2 hours daily was 2.50 times higher than those without screen behavior ( OR =2.50). The risk of developing depression with a total screen time of more than 2 hours daily was 3.15 times higher those whithout screen behavior ( OR =3.15). The risk of developing depression among students playing video games >0-1, >1-2, >2 h daily was 2.14, 2.50, 4.90 times that of those without screen behaviors ( OR =2.14, 2.50, 4.90), and showed an upward trend with the increase of educational stage ( P <0.05).
Conclusions
Screen behaviors of primary and middle school students in Jiangxi Province are positively associated with the risk of anxiety and depression, but the total daily video time of >1-2 h on weekends was negatively associated with state anxiety. It is necessary to control the screen time as much as possible and reduce the risk of anxiety and depression.
5.Clinical guidelines for the treatment of ankylosing spondylitis combined with lower cervical fracture in adults (version 2024)
Qingde WANG ; Yuan HE ; Bohua CHEN ; Tongwei CHU ; Jinpeng DU ; Jian DONG ; Haoyu FENG ; Shunwu FAN ; Shiqing FENG ; Yanzheng GAO ; Zhong GUAN ; Hua GUO ; Yong HAI ; Lijun HE ; Dianming JIANG ; Jianyuan JIANG ; Bin LIN ; Bin LIU ; Baoge LIU ; Chunde LI ; Fang LI ; Feng LI ; Guohua LYU ; Li LI ; Qi LIAO ; Weishi LI ; Xiaoguang LIU ; Hongjian LIU ; Yong LIU ; Zhongjun LIU ; Shibao LU ; Yong QIU ; Limin RONG ; Yong SHEN ; Huiyong SHEN ; Jun SHU ; Yueming SONG ; Tiansheng SUN ; Yan WANG ; Zhe WANG ; Zheng WANG ; Hong XIA ; Guoyong YIN ; Jinglong YAN ; Wen YUAN ; Zhaoming YE ; Jie ZHAO ; Jianguo ZHANG ; Yue ZHU ; Yingjie ZHOU ; Zhongmin ZHANG ; Wei MEI ; Dingjun HAO ; Baorong HE
Chinese Journal of Trauma 2024;40(2):97-106
Ankylosing spondylitis (AS) combined with lower cervical fracture is often categorized into unstable fracture, with a high incidence of neurological injury and a high rate of disability and morbidity. As factors such as shoulder occlusion may affect the accuracy of X-ray imaging diagnosis, it is often easily misdiagnosed at the primary diagnosis. Non-operative treatment has complications such as bone nonunion and the possibility of secondary neurological damage, while the timing, access and choice of surgical treatment are still controversial. Currently, there are no clinical practice guidelines for the treatment of AS combined with lower cervical fracture with or without dislocation. To this end, the Spinal Trauma Group of Orthopedics Branch of Chinese Medical Doctor Association organized experts to formulate Clinical guidelines for the treatment of ankylosing spondylitis combined with lower cervical fracture in adults ( version 2024) in accordance with the principles of evidence-based medicine, scientificity and practicality, in which 11 recommendations were put forward in terms of the diagnosis, imaging evaluation, typing and treatment, etc, to provide guidance for the diagnosis and treatment of AS combined with lower cervical fracture.
6.Host protection against Omicron BA.2.2 sublineages by prior vaccination in spring 2022 COVID-19 outbreak in Shanghai.
Ziyu FU ; Dongguo LIANG ; Wei ZHANG ; Dongling SHI ; Yuhua MA ; Dong WEI ; Junxiang XI ; Sizhe YANG ; Xiaoguang XU ; Di TIAN ; Zhaoqing ZHU ; Mingquan GUO ; Lu JIANG ; Shuting YU ; Shuai WANG ; Fangyin JIANG ; Yun LING ; Shengyue WANG ; Saijuan CHEN ; Feng LIU ; Yun TAN ; Xiaohong FAN
Frontiers of Medicine 2023;17(3):562-575
The Omicron family of SARS-CoV-2 variants are currently driving the COVID-19 pandemic. Here we analyzed the clinical laboratory test results of 9911 Omicron BA.2.2 sublineages-infected symptomatic patients without earlier infection histories during a SARS-CoV-2 outbreak in Shanghai in spring 2022. Compared to an earlier patient cohort infected by SARS-CoV-2 prototype strains in 2020, BA.2.2 infection led to distinct fluctuations of pathophysiological markers in the peripheral blood. In particular, severe/critical cases of COVID-19 post BA.2.2 infection were associated with less pro-inflammatory macrophage activation and stronger interferon alpha response in the bronchoalveolar microenvironment. Importantly, the abnormal biomarkers were significantly subdued in individuals who had been immunized by 2 or 3 doses of SARS-CoV-2 prototype-inactivated vaccines, supporting the estimation of an overall 96.02% of protection rate against severe/critical disease in the 4854 cases in our BA.2.2 patient cohort with traceable vaccination records. Furthermore, even though age was a critical risk factor of the severity of COVID-19 post BA.2.2 infection, vaccination-elicited protection against severe/critical COVID-19 reached 90.15% in patients aged ≽ 60 years old. Together, our study delineates the pathophysiological features of Omicron BA.2.2 sublineages and demonstrates significant protection conferred by prior prototype-based inactivated vaccines.

7.Risk factors of poor renal prognosis in coronary artery bypass grafting surgery-associated acute kidney injury patients
Xiaoguang FAN ; Zehua SHAO ; Zhenzhen YOU ; Shuai HUO ; Zhu ZHANG ; Fengmin SHAO
Chinese Journal of Nephrology 2023;39(8):569-575
Objective:To explore the risk factors of poor renal prognosis in patients with coronary artery bypass surgery (CABG)-associated acute kidney injury (AKI), and establish a preliminary clinical risk prediction model for chronic kidney disease (CKD) progression in CABG-associated AKI patients, and evaluate its predictive efficacy.Methods:It was a retrospective, observational cohort study. The study subjects were patients who underwent CABG at Central China Fuwai Hospital from January 1, 2018 to December 31, 2020, with a baseline estimated glomerular filtration rate (eGFR)>60 ml·min -1·(1.73 m 2) -1 and postoperative complication of AKI. The patients were followed up for 90 days after discharge from hospital. The endpoint event was defined as progression to CKD after 90 days of the occurrence of CABG-associated AKI. The patients were divided into CKD group and non-CKD group based on whether they experienced endpoint events. The baseline clinical data were compared between the two groups. The logistic regression model was used to analyze the risk factors of endpoint event. The receiver-operating characteristic curve was drawn to evaluate the performance of the clinical risk prediction model for predicting poor renal prognosis in CABG-associated AKI patients. Results:A total of 124 CABG-associated AKI patients were enrolled in the study, including 95 males and 29 females, aged (62.57±9.61) years old. Thirty-eight patients (30.8%) progressed to new-onset CKD 90 days after CABG-associated AKI. Compared with non-CKD group, CKD group had lower preoperative hemoglobin ( t=2.778, P=0.006) and baseline eGFR ( t=3.603, P<0.001), higher proportion of women ( χ2=10.714, P=0.001), and higher preoperative blood NT-proBNP ( Z=-2.150, P=0.030) and discharged serum creatinine ( Z=-5.290, P<0.001). The multivariate logistic regression analysis results revealed that female ( OR=5.179, 95% CI 1.535-17.477, P=0.008), high preoperative blood NT-proBNP ( OR=1.049, 95% CI 1.004-1.095, P=0.032), low baseline eGFR ( OR=0.928, 95% CI 0.889-0.968, P=0.001), and high serum creatinine at discharge ( OR=1.019, 95% CI 1.009-1.029, P<0.001) were independent influencing factors of CABG-associated AKI to CKD. The clinical risk prediction model including female, preoperative blood NT-proBNP, preoperative baseline eGFR, and serum creatinine at discharge produced a moderate performance for predicting CABG-associated AKI to CKD ( AUC=0.872, 95% CI 0.806-0.939, P<0.001). Conclusion:Patients with CABG-associated AKI are at high risks for new-onset CKD. Female, preoperative high NT-proBNP, preoperative low baseline eGFR and high serum creatinine at discharge can help identify patients with a high risk of CABG-associated AKI to CKD.
8.Clinical guideline for diagnosis and treatment of adult ankylosing spondylitis combined with thoracolumbar fracture (version 2023)
Jianan ZHANG ; Bohua CHEN ; Tongwei CHU ; Yirui CHEN ; Jian DONG ; Haoyu FENG ; Shunwu FAN ; Shiqing FENG ; Yanzheng GAO ; Zhong GUAN ; Yong HAI ; Lijun HE ; Yuan HE ; Dianming JIANG ; Jianyuan JIANG ; Bin LIN ; Bin LIU ; Baoge LIU ; Dechun LI ; Fang LI ; Feng LI ; Guohua LYU ; Li LI ; Qi LIAO ; Weishi LI ; Xiaoguang LIU ; Yong LIU ; Zhongjun LIU ; Shibao LU ; Wei MEI ; Yong QIU ; Limin RONG ; Yong SHEN ; Huiyong SHEN ; Jun SHU ; Yueming SONG ; Honghui SUN ; Tiansheng SUN ; Yan WANG ; Zhe WANG ; Zheng WANG ; Yongming XI ; Hong XIA ; Jinglong YAN ; Liang YAN ; Wen YUAN ; Gang ZHAO ; Jie ZHAO ; Jianguo ZHANG ; Xiaozhong ZHOU ; Yue ZHU ; Yingze ZHANG ; Dingjun HAO ; Baorong HE
Chinese Journal of Trauma 2023;39(3):204-213
Ankylosing spondylitis (AS) combined with spinal fractures with thoracic and lumbar fracture as the most common type shows characteristics of unstable fracture, high incidence of nerve injury, high mortality and high disability rate. The diagnosis may be missed because it is mostly caused by low-energy injury, when spinal rigidity and osteoporosis have a great impact on the accuracy of imaging examination. At the same time, the treatment choices are controversial, with no relevant specifications. Non-operative treatments can easily lead to bone nonunion, pseudoarthrosis and delayed nerve injury, while surgeries may be failed due to internal fixation failure. At present, there are no evidence-based guidelines for the diagnosis and treatment of AS combined with thoracic and lumbar fracture. In this context, the Spinal Trauma Academic Group of Orthopedics Branch of Chinese Medical Doctor Association organized experts to formulate the Clinical guideline for the diagnosis and treatment of adult ankylosing spondylitis combined with thoracolumbar fracture ( version 2023) by following the principles of evidence-based medicine and systematically review related literatures. Ten recommendations on the diagnosis, imaging evaluation, classification and treatment of AS combined with thoracic and lumbar fracture were put forward, aiming to standardize the clinical diagnosis and treatment of such disorder.
9.Evidence-based guideline for clinical diagnosis and treatment of acute combination fractures of the atlas and axis in adults (version 2023)
Yukun DU ; Dageng HUANG ; Wei TIAN ; Dingjun HAO ; Yongming XI ; Baorong HE ; Bohua CHEN ; Tongwei CHU ; Jian DONG ; Jun DONG ; Haoyu FENG ; Shunwu FAN ; Shiqing FENG ; Yanzheng GAO ; Zhong GUAN ; Yong HAI ; Lijun HE ; Yuan HE ; Dianming JIANG ; Jianyuan JIANG ; Weiqing KONG ; Bin LIN ; Bin LIU ; Baoge LIU ; Chunde LI ; Fang LI ; Feng LI ; Guohua LYU ; Li LI ; Qi LIAO ; Weishi LI ; Xiaoguang LIU ; Yong LIU ; Zhongjun LIU ; Shibao LU ; Fei LUO ; Jianyi LI ; Yong QIU ; Limin RONG ; Yong SHEN ; Huiyong SHEN ; Jun SHU ; Yueming SONG ; Tiansheng SUN ; Jiang SHAO ; Jiwei TIAN ; Yan WANG ; Zhe WANG ; Zheng WANG ; Xiangyang WANG ; Hong XIA ; Jinglong YAN ; Liang YAN ; Wen YUAN ; Jie ZHAO ; Jianguo ZHANG ; Yue ZHU ; Xuhui ZHOU ; Mingwei ZHAO
Chinese Journal of Trauma 2023;39(4):299-308
The acute combination fractures of the atlas and axis in adults have a higher rate of neurological injury and early death compared with atlas or axial fractures alone. Currently, the diagnosis and treatment choices of acute combination fractures of the atlas and axis in adults are controversial because of the lack of standards for implementation. Non-operative treatments have a high incidence of bone nonunion and complications, while surgeries may easily lead to the injury of the vertebral artery, spinal cord and nerve root. At present, there are no evidence-based Chinese guidelines for the diagnosis and treatment of acute combination fractures of the atlas and axis in adults. To provide orthopedic surgeons with the most up-to-date and effective information in treating acute combination fractures of the atlas and axis in adults, the Spinal Trauma Group of Orthopedic Branch of Chinese Medical Doctor Association organized experts in the field of spinal trauma to develop the Evidence-based guideline for clinical diagnosis and treatment of acute combination fractures of the atlas and axis in adults ( version 2023) by referring to the "Management of acute combination fractures of the atlas and axis in adults" published by American Association of Neurological Surgeons (AANS)/Congress of Neurological Surgeons (CNS) in 2013 and the relevant Chinese and English literatures. Ten recommendations were made concerning the radiological diagnosis, stability judgment, treatment rules, treatment options and complications based on medical evidence, aiming to provide a reference for the diagnosis and treatment of acute combination fractures of the atlas and axis in adults.
10.Study on the relationship between habitat factors and the distribution
Yitian GAO ; Fan GAO ; Da XYU ; Fengyang MIN ; Jiasheng WANG ; Yi YUAN ; Kongxian ZHU ; Xiaoguang LIU ; Yunchao ZHANG
Journal of Public Health and Preventive Medicine 2022;33(3):22-27
Objective To explore the relationship between the distribution characteristics and the habitat factors of the invasive B. straminea in South China. Methods From October 2016 to August 2017, the breeding condition and habitat factors of B. straminea were investigated in the rivers of Shenzhen and its adjacent areas in the dry season, normal season and wet reason. The generalized additive model (GAM) was used to study the main habitat factors affecting the distribution density of B. straminea. Results The distribution characteristics of B. straminea showed obvious aggregation and unevenness in space. In terms of time, the density of snails was the highest in the dry season, followed by the normal water season and the least in the wet season. The GAM model analysis showed that the main habitat factors affecting the distribution density of B. straminea were water depth, water temperature, flow velocity, dissolved oxygen, and total phosphorus. When the flow velocity and water temperature were 0.25 m / s and 26 °C, respectively, the largest distribution density of snails might appear. The distribution density of B. straminea was positively correlated with dissolved oxygen and total phosphorus. Conclusion B. straminea is suitable to live in the water environment with poor water quality. In the future, the monitoring should be strengthened to provide reference for the prevention and control of the spread of the snails.
